What is the average rate of change of the function f(x) = 5x ^ 2 + 20x between x = 0 and x = 0.5

Answer:

  22.5

Step-by-step explanation:

The average rate of change on the interval [a, b] is the ratio ...

  (f(b) -f(x))/(b -a)

For your function and interval, it is ...

  (f(0.5) -f(0))/(0.5 -0)

Since f(0) = 0, this reduces to ...

  average rate of change = 2·f(0.5) = 2(5(0.5)² +20(0.5)) = 2(5/4 +10)

  average rate of change = 22.5
